Becoming a Business Assurance Analyst with Capita PIP

As the Business Assurance Analyst, you will be responsible for providing assurance to our senior management team and ensuring compliancy across all service lines- including but not limited to; contractual and legislative requirements, system and processes, service quality and internal governance.

This will be achieved through risk-based audit programmes and providing feedback to the leadership team, enabling their implementation of improvements.

You will have the opportunity to broaden your existing skills and experience by gaining exposure to first line responsibility for business continuity, stakeholder management and Health, Safety & Environmental disciplines.

What you will do:

* Plan and deliver a range of audits, producing clear and concise audit reports for the business in a timely manner
* Work with Head of Risk Assurance and Compliance to design, develop, implement and review audit tools and techniques
* Utilise available intelligence to prioritise audit activity, supporting the improvement of business processes and continuous improvement of service delivery
* Support the Head of Risk Assurance and Compliance with the review and management of the annual audit plan
* Escalate breaches of contract to the Head of Risk Assurance and Compliance in a timely manner
* Keep up to date with legislative and industry related changes

Your experience will include:

* Excellent written & communication skills
* To take full end-to-end ownership and manage multiple cases simultaneously
* Excellent analytical skills and understanding of management information
* A self-starter, with a proven ability to prioritise and manage your own workload with minimal input and supervision
* Excellent analysis skills and experienced in using data or evidence to draw clear conclusions
* Confident communicator, comfortable liaising with staff at all levels within a business
* Competent MS Office packages
* Preferably IIA or related audit and risk qualifications
* Understanding of risk-based audit methodology and audit planning
* Previous experience of planning and conducting internal audit and assurance activity

About Capita PIP

We carry out Personal Independence Payment assessments on behalf of the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P) in Wales and the Midlands, and the Department for Communities (DfC) in Northern Ireland - and we're searching for a Business Assurance Analyst to join the team in Birmingham.
